Abstract

In this work, a proportional/integral (PI) material-balance scheme to control continuous free-radical solution homopolymer (possibly open-loop unstable) reactors with level, temperature, and flow measurements is presented. First, the combination of inventory and constructive control ideas yields (i) a nonlinear feedforward state-feedback static passive controller whose closed-loop dynamics are the limiting behavior attainable by robust feedback control and (ii) the related solvability conditions with physical meaning. Then, such a limiting behavior is recovered via a measurement-driven dynamic control system with (i) linear PI-type decentralized volume and cascade temperature controllers and (ii) material-balance monomer and molecular weight (MW) controllers.
